Output 4ea27529b4f13cbae3df2060349abb7b27d8ce1fdd2d40e85cffbe306c809528:10

value
146210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de1e8324e3768a0806b7e3e678cd4ed43210c608 OP_EQUAL
address
3MwUVAGWp1Qf7JBcGhinRDkzp5hHur9i6W
transaction
4ea27529b4f13cbae3df2060349abb7b27d8ce1fdd2d40e85cffbe306c809528
confirmations
198164
spent
true